pycharm如何更改語(yǔ)言 多語(yǔ)言切換方法匯總

pycharm 中更改語(yǔ)言并進(jìn)行多語(yǔ)言切換可以通過(guò)以下步驟實(shí)現(xiàn):1) 打開(kāi)設(shè)置窗口(file -> settings 或 pycharm -> preferences),2) 導(dǎo)航到 appearance & behavior -> appearance,3) 在 “override default fonts by” 下選擇語(yǔ)言。pycharm 會(huì)根據(jù)項(xiàng)目語(yǔ)言環(huán)境自動(dòng)調(diào)整代碼提示和文檔注釋的語(yǔ)言,使用虛擬環(huán)境可以管理不同語(yǔ)言的依賴和配置,避免環(huán)境沖突。

pycharm如何更改語(yǔ)言 多語(yǔ)言切換方法匯總

要在 PyCharm 中更改語(yǔ)言并進(jìn)行多語(yǔ)言切換,首先需要了解 PyCharm 的語(yǔ)言設(shè)置機(jī)制。PyCharm 支持多種語(yǔ)言,并且切換語(yǔ)言的過(guò)程相對(duì)簡(jiǎn)單,但也有一些需要注意的地方。

PyCharm 中的語(yǔ)言設(shè)置不僅僅是界面語(yǔ)言的切換,它還涉及到代碼提示、文檔注釋等多方面的語(yǔ)言支持。讓我分享一下我在使用 PyCharm 過(guò)程中積累的經(jīng)驗(yàn)和一些常見(jiàn)的陷阱。

PyCharm 界面語(yǔ)言的切換可以通過(guò)以下步驟實(shí)現(xiàn):

 # 打開(kāi) PyCharm 的設(shè)置窗口 File -> Settings (windows/linux) 或 PyCharm -> Preferences (Mac) <h1>在設(shè)置窗口中,導(dǎo)航到 Appearance & Behavior -> Appearance</h1><h1>在 "Override default fonts by" 選項(xiàng)下,選擇你想要的語(yǔ)言</h1>

這個(gè)過(guò)程看似簡(jiǎn)單,但在實(shí)際操作中,你可能會(huì)遇到一些問(wèn)題。比如,某些語(yǔ)言可能沒(méi)有完全翻譯好,導(dǎo)致部分菜單項(xiàng)仍然是英文顯示。此外,如果你使用的是社區(qū)版(Community Edition),某些高級(jí)功能的語(yǔ)言支持可能會(huì)有所欠缺。

對(duì)于代碼提示和文檔注釋的語(yǔ)言切換,PyCharm 會(huì)根據(jù)你當(dāng)前項(xiàng)目中的語(yǔ)言環(huán)境自動(dòng)調(diào)整。如果你在使用 python 編寫(xiě)代碼,PyCharm 會(huì)提供相應(yīng)的 Python 文檔和提示。如果你切換到其他語(yǔ)言,比如 JavaScript,PyCharm 也會(huì)相應(yīng)地調(diào)整代碼提示和文檔注釋的語(yǔ)言。

不過(guò),這里有一個(gè)小技巧:如果你在一個(gè)多語(yǔ)言的項(xiàng)目中工作,可以通過(guò)設(shè)置不同的虛擬環(huán)境來(lái)管理不同語(yǔ)言的依賴和配置。這樣可以避免語(yǔ)言環(huán)境的沖突,同時(shí)也讓你的開(kāi)發(fā)環(huán)境更加靈活。

 # 創(chuàng)建一個(gè)新的虛擬環(huán)境 conda create -n my_js_env python=3.8 conda activate my_js_env <h1>安裝 JavaScript 相關(guān)的依賴</h1><p>npm install</p><h1>在 PyCharm 中,選擇這個(gè)虛擬環(huán)境作為你的項(xiàng)目解釋器</h1>

在實(shí)際開(kāi)發(fā)中,我發(fā)現(xiàn)使用虛擬環(huán)境不僅可以管理不同語(yǔ)言的依賴,還能有效地隔離不同項(xiàng)目的環(huán)境,避免因?yàn)榄h(huán)境變量的沖突而導(dǎo)致的開(kāi)發(fā)問(wèn)題。

關(guān)于多語(yǔ)言切換的常見(jiàn)錯(cuò)誤和調(diào)試技巧,我在這里總結(jié)了一些:

  • 語(yǔ)言包未完全安裝:有時(shí)候你會(huì)發(fā)現(xiàn)某些菜單項(xiàng)仍然是英文,這可能是由于語(yǔ)言包未完全安裝造成的。你可以通過(guò)重新下載和安裝語(yǔ)言包來(lái)解決這個(gè)問(wèn)題。
  • 插件沖突:某些插件可能與你選擇的語(yǔ)言不兼容,導(dǎo)致界面顯示異常。你可以嘗試禁用這些插件,或者尋找與你所選語(yǔ)言兼容的替代插件。
  • 緩存問(wèn)題:PyCharm 會(huì)緩存一些語(yǔ)言設(shè)置,如果你頻繁切換語(yǔ)言,可能會(huì)導(dǎo)致緩存問(wèn)題。你可以通過(guò)清除緩存來(lái)解決這個(gè)問(wèn)題。
 # 清除 PyCharm 緩存 File -> Invalidate Caches / Restart 

性能優(yōu)化和最佳實(shí)踐方面,使用多語(yǔ)言環(huán)境時(shí),我建議你:

  • 保持代碼的可讀性:無(wú)論你使用哪種語(yǔ)言,確保你的代碼具有良好的可讀性和注釋。這樣,當(dāng)你需要在不同語(yǔ)言之間切換時(shí),可以更快地理解代碼的邏輯。
  • 使用版本控制:在多語(yǔ)言項(xiàng)目中,使用版本控制系統(tǒng)(如 git)來(lái)管理你的代碼。這樣,你可以輕松地回滾到之前的版本,或者在不同分支上進(jìn)行不同語(yǔ)言的開(kāi)發(fā)。
  • 定期備份:多語(yǔ)言環(huán)境下的開(kāi)發(fā)可能會(huì)更加復(fù)雜,定期備份你的項(xiàng)目可以防止因?yàn)檎Z(yǔ)言切換或環(huán)境配置錯(cuò)誤而導(dǎo)致的數(shù)據(jù)丟失

通過(guò)這些方法和技巧,你可以在 PyCharm 中輕松地進(jìn)行多語(yǔ)言切換,并提高你的開(kāi)發(fā)效率。我希望這些經(jīng)驗(yàn)?zāi)軒椭阍诙嗾Z(yǔ)言開(kāi)發(fā)中避免一些常見(jiàn)的陷阱,并找到最適合你的工作流程。

? 版權(quán)聲明
THE END
喜歡就支持一下吧
點(diǎn)贊10 分享